Biography
Indian vocalist Anushka Shahaney, who performs under the mononym Anushqa, first attracted widespread attention in 2015 when she reached the finals of season one of the televised talent series The Stage. A classically trained artist, she soon transitioned into Bollywood by supplying the tracks “Lost Without You” and “Stay a Little Longer” for the soundtrack of the 2017 feature Half Girlfriend.
Born and raised in Mumbai, Anushqa cultivated an early passion for music and studied Western classical technique at Trinity College. While completing a psychology degree in Canada, she decided to commit to music professionally, began uploading clips of her singing, and was subsequently recruited by producers for the inaugural season of the Indian reality competition The Stage. A public favorite throughout the run, she advanced to the final round only to finish behind winner Yatharth Ratnum.
Following the broadcast, she made her playback-singing debut with the same two songs for director Mohit Suri’s screen version of the novel Half Girlfriend. The album earned favorable notices, and “Stay a Little Longer” brought Anushqa a nomination for Upcoming Female Vocalist of the Year at the Mirchi Music Awards. In 2018 she issued her first solo single, “Ecstasy.”
